The numerical relativity group at the University of Jena anticipates the availability of a postdoc position starting September 2011, and a PhD position in April 2011.

The gravity group at Jena includes Marcus Ansorg, Bernd Bruegmann, Reinhard Meinel, and Gerhard Schaefer, and also involves applied mathematician Gerhard Zumbusch. There is the opportunity to participate in a wide range of research activities offered by the SFB/Transregio grant on “Gravitational Wave Astronomy”, see http://wwwsfb.tpi.uni-jena.de. Applicants with a background in numerical relativity, but also in the area of gravitational wave science or associated computational methods are especially encouraged to apply.
